Output 85e659409615eef9d7832bce29cc4b2fbccf663e9e93f686f0dccd6ef843bb51:1

value
1168301559
script pubkey
OP_0 OP_PUSHBYTES_20 635cb256f0f1099c356ec3d2b1dd6639f26f6429
address
ltc1qvdwty4hs7yyecdtwc0ftrhtx88ex7epfpcx8ak
transaction
85e659409615eef9d7832bce29cc4b2fbccf663e9e93f686f0dccd6ef843bb51
spent
true